P. Miao et al., Electrostatic generation and theoretical modelling of ultra fine spray of ceramic suspensions for thin film preparation, J ELECTROST, 51, 2001, pp. 43-49
An electrostatic atomization technique has been developed to generate ultra
-fine spray of ZrO2 and SiC ceramic suspensions with a droplet size of abou
t 4 mum and a narrow size distribution for preparing thin films. It is well
known that electrostatic atomization in cone-jet mode is the most suitable
technique to generate the desired aerosol. Experimental and modelling resu
lts showed that droplet size and spray current obey theoretical prediction
of scaling law and that droplet transport process is in agreement with expe
rimental observation. ZrO2 and SIC thin films prepared this way were found
to be homogenous. (C) 2001 Elsevier Science B.V. All rights reserved.
